Arrays store elements in contiguous memory locations, while linked lists store elements in nodes with pointers to the next node.
Arrays have fixed size, while linked lists can dynamically grow or shrink.
Accessing elements in arrays is faster (O(1)), while in linked lists it is slower (O(n)).
Inserting or deleting elements in arrays can be inefficient, while in linked lists it is efficient.
